Hi Sylas!
The answers are "no", "yes" and "no".
"No", because I had already updated the member message lists.
"Yes", because webhosting companies limit the amount of CPU cycles you can use per unit time, and when many people just by chance happen to post simultaneously, processes could get terminated in mid-stream resulting in corrupted data files. That's the reason for the links to rebuilding various types of data files.
And "no", because the topic approval process didn't cause the problem in this case, I did. Of course, if I haven't really eradicated this bug yet, then we may need to rebuild the member message lists again, but hopefully things are okay now.
The datafiles most often affected by preemptive process termination are the search data base files. That's probably because they're the last file updated, and, especially for large forums with lots of threads like Evolution, it takes a long time.

Profile Improvements
The following changes have just been released:
  • The preferences page has gone away. The settings for cookies and for the number of threads listed have moved to the profile page.
  • The profile page has some improvements. The settings mentioned above have moved to the profile page. Changing your username is now easier than ever. There is a link for clearing all cookies for EvC Forum at the bottom of the page.
  • The default for saving cookies, which means you don't have to login every time you start a new browser session, is now on. If you don't want to save cookies across browser sessions, go to your profile page and set the setting for saving login information to "no".
Please report problems and bugs by posting to this thread, or by sending email to Admin.
